What you've described sounds mostly how it is supposed to work. Students in group A can read and post to each other but can't read group B's post, and vice versa. Students in group B should be able to enter the forum, but not read anything posted by students in group A.

If you want groups to be able to read each others post, use visible groups, and if you want everyone to be able to read and write, turn groups off on the forum.
